Algorithms create foundry-ready photonic circuits

Дата публикации: 24-07-2026 17:40:08

Photonic microchips can process data at extremely high speeds and are embedded in a wide variety of today's technologies. Researchers at the Max Planck Institute for the Science of Light (MPL) and Harvard University have now succeeded in developing three functional components for such chips that are up to 500 times smaller than conventional designs. The researchers used inverse design, a computer algorithm, to achieve this. The results are published in Nature Communications.
